OMHEX Acquires Shares In The National Stock Exchange Of Lithuania

Date 03/03/2004

OMHEX has agreed with various leading Lithuanian securities market participants and financial investors to acquire their shares in the National Stock Exchange of Lithuania (NSEL). OMHEX has today filed an application with the Lithuanian Securities Commission for permission to obtain 34 percent of the shares in the NSEL. Permission is required when acquiring more than 10 percent of the shares.

"We are pleased that a number of important Lithuanian market participants support our efforts and strategy in Lithuania, and that they have decided to sell their shares to us ahead of the privatization of the shares owned by the Government of Lithuania," said Magnus Böcker, President and CEO of OMHEX.

As announced earlier, OMHEX intends to participate in the privatization process of the NSEL and the Central Securities Depository of Lithuania (CSDL). As a logical next step to further its strategy to integrate the Nordic and Baltic securities markets, OMHEX intends to submit an offer for the shares of NSEL and CSDL that are for sale in the privatization process.
